1. Durability

A flight case’s primary function is to protect a valuable instrument from the rigors of air travel. Therefore, durability represents a critical factor in determining the effectiveness of a guitar flight case. This encompasses the materials used, construction methods, and the case’s ability to withstand impacts, pressure changes, and environmental factors.

  • Materials

    The choice of materials significantly influences a case’s protective capabilities. High-quality plywood, ABS plastic, and carbon fiber offer varying degrees of impact resistance and structural integrity. Plywood provides a good balance of strength and affordability, while ABS plastic offers enhanced impact protection and water resistance. Carbon fiber represents the premium option, offering exceptional strength and lightweight properties, albeit at a higher cost.

  • Construction

    The construction methods employed play a vital role in overall durability. Reinforced corners, heavy-duty latches, and tightly sealed edges contribute to a case’s ability to withstand impacts and prevent damage. Cases with aluminum valances and ball corners offer superior protection against drops and collisions. Furthermore, the quality of adhesives and internal bracing impacts the case’s long-term structural integrity.

  • Impact Resistance

    The ability to absorb and dissipate impact forces is crucial for protecting the instrument within. Cases lined with dense, shock-absorbing foam or custom-molded interiors effectively cushion the guitar against bumps and jolts during transit. The thickness and density of the padding directly correlate with the level of impact protection offered.

  • Environmental Protection

    Beyond physical impacts, a durable case also safeguards against environmental factors. A well-sealed case protects against moisture, humidity changes, and temperature fluctuations that can damage delicate wood finishes and internal components. Water-resistant seals and airtight closures are crucial for maintaining a stable internal environment.

2. Fit

A proper fit is paramount when selecting a flight case. A case that fits the guitar too loosely allows the instrument to shift during transit, increasing the risk of damage. Conversely, a case that is too tight can exert undue pressure on the instrument, potentially causing structural issues. Therefore, the precise fit of a flight case directly impacts the level of protection provided.

  • Interior Dimensions

    Accurate interior dimensions are fundamental. The case should precisely accommodate the guitar’s body style, including its length, width, and depth. For example, a dreadnought acoustic guitar requires a larger case than a parlor-sized guitar. Precise measurements ensure a snug fit without excessive pressure points.

  • Neck Support

    Adequate neck support prevents the guitar’s neck from moving during transport. This support system, often a padded block or cradle, should securely hold the neck in place, minimizing the risk of bending or breakage due to impacts. Cases with adjustable neck supports offer greater flexibility for different guitar models.

  • Interior Padding

    The type and placement of interior padding contribute significantly to the overall fit and protection. Dense, contoured foam conforms to the guitar’s shape, providing a secure and cushioned environment. Padding should completely surround the instrument, eliminating any voids where it could shift or rattle. Specialized compartments for accessories, like capos or tuners, further optimize space and prevent items from contacting the instrument.

  • Body Cavity Support

    For acoustic guitars, supporting the internal body cavity is crucial. This often involves a padded block or brace placed inside the body to prevent the top or back from collapsing under pressure during transit. This is particularly important for larger-bodied acoustic instruments that are more susceptible to structural damage.

3. Weight

The weight of a guitar flight case presents a critical consideration, impacting both portability and practicality. While robust construction and ample padding are essential for protection, excessive weight can make transporting the case cumbersome and potentially lead to increased baggage fees during air travel. Finding the optimal balance between protection and weight is crucial for selecting the best flight case.

Heavier cases, typically constructed from materials like plywood, offer excellent durability and impact resistance. However, their weight can be a significant disadvantage, especially for musicians who frequently travel or need to navigate airports and public transportation. Conversely, lighter cases made from materials like carbon fiber provide excellent protection while minimizing weight, but often come at a premium cost. The choice depends on individual needs and priorities. A touring musician might prioritize a lightweight carbon fiber case, accepting the higher cost to reduce travel strain. A musician who travels less frequently might opt for a more affordable, heavier plywood case.

4. Security

Security forms a critical aspect of a best guitar flight case, safeguarding valuable instruments from theft or unauthorized access during transit and storage. Cases incorporating robust locking mechanisms and other security features offer enhanced protection, providing musicians with peace of mind. The consequences of inadequate security can range from inconvenience and financial loss to the irreplaceable loss of a cherished instrument. For instance, a musician arriving at a gig to find their instrument stolen from its case faces not only the expense of replacement but also the potential disruption of performances and recordings. The historical context underscores this importance before specialized flight cases, musicians often resorted to less secure methods, leading to increased vulnerability to theft.

Several key features contribute to flight case security. High-quality TSA-approved locks are essential, allowing security personnel to inspect the case without causing damage. Reinforced latches and hinges resist tampering, providing an additional layer of protection against forced entry. Some cases even incorporate features like steel cable loops for attaching the case to a fixed object, further deterring theft. 5. Portability

Portability represents a crucial factor in determining the practicality of a best guitar flight case. While protection remains paramount, a case’s ease of transport significantly impacts its usability, particularly for musicians who frequently travel. The connection between portability and a best guitar flight case lies in the balance between robust protection and manageable weight and dimensions. A cumbersome case, while potentially offering superior protection, can create logistical challenges, especially when navigating airports, public transportation, or stairs. This can lead to physical strain and potentially increase the risk of accidental drops or impacts due to handling difficulties. For example, a heavy, bulky case might prove unwieldy on crowded public transport, increasing the likelihood of bumping into other passengers or obstacles, potentially damaging the instrument inside.

Several factors contribute to a case’s portability. In addition to weight, features like comfortable handles, smooth-rolling wheels, and a balanced center of gravity significantly influence ease of transport. Cases with in-line skate wheels and telescoping handles facilitate effortless movement, reducing strain on the user, especially over long distances. Furthermore, the case’s overall dimensions play a role. A compact, well-designed case occupies less space, simplifying storage in overhead compartments or tight spaces. Question 1: What distinguishes a flight case from a standard guitar case?

Flight cases are designed specifically to withstand the rigors of air travel, offering superior protection compared to standard cases. They typically feature robust construction using materials like plywood, ABS plastic, or carbon fiber, reinforced corners, and dense protective padding. Standard cases, often made of lighter materials like molded plastic or wood, offer adequate protection for everyday use but lack the structural integrity and impact resistance of flight cases.

Question 2: Are TSA-approved locks essential for a flight case?

TSA-approved locks permit security personnel to inspect the case without causing damage. While not strictly mandatory, they are highly recommended for air travel. These locks allow for inspection while deterring unauthorized access, offering a balance between security and compliance with airport regulations.

Question 3: How does one determine the correct case size for a specific guitar model?

Consulting the manufacturer’s specifications for both the guitar and the case is crucial. Precise measurements of the guitar’s body length, width, depth, and scale length should be compared to the case’s internal dimensions to ensure a proper fit. A snug fit prevents shifting during transit while avoiding undue pressure on the instrument.

Question 4: What type of padding offers the best protection inside a flight case?

Dense, closed-cell foam, often custom-molded to the shape of the guitar, provides superior impact absorption and cushioning. This type of padding conforms to the instrument’s contours, minimizing movement and effectively distributing impact forces. The thickness and density of the padding correlate directly with the level of protection offered.

Question 5: Can flight cases protect against extreme temperature and humidity fluctuations?

High-quality flight cases offer a degree of environmental protection, particularly those with airtight seals and water-resistant exteriors. While they cannot completely eliminate the effects of extreme temperature or humidity, they create a more stable internal environment, minimizing the risk of damage caused by rapid fluctuations during air travel. However, prolonged exposure to extreme conditions should still be avoided.

Question 6: How does one maintain and care for a guitar flight case?

Regular inspection of the case for any signs of wear or damage is essential. Hardware, such as latches, hinges, and wheels, should be checked for proper function and lubricated if necessary. Cleaning the exterior with a damp cloth and mild detergent removes dirt and grime. Proper maintenance ensures the case remains in optimal condition, maximizing its protective capabilities and extending its lifespan.
